Understanding ‘Shopify customize checkout’
Checkout pages in Shopify stores typically follow a standardized layout, with the customer’s information on the left and the order summary on the right.
Although you can’t change the core layout of the checkout page, you do have the freedom to make visual tweaks and add extra fields. Even minor cosmetic adjustments can significantly impact the checkout experience and boost conversion rates.
However, if you desire a more profound alteration to the checkout structure, there are some important considerations to bear in mind. Currently, only Shopify Plus merchants possess the capability to influence the checkout logic by editing the checkout.liquid template.
Nevertheless, this approach comes with certain risks and is not encouraged by Shopify. Modifying the checkout code carries the following potential hazards:
- Website Functionality: There’s a risk of breaking website functionality, preventing customers from completing their orders.
- Integration Challenges: Integrating third-party code can be complex and labor-intensive.
- Security Concerns: Third-party JavaScript may access sensitive data, potentially leading to security vulnerabilities.
Moreover, Shopify is working on a checkout extension system, enabling developers to build apps for tailored checkout experiences. It will help to enhance the customization possibilities beyond what’s currently available through existing Shopify apps.
Additionally, by using Shopify’s design elements and branding tools, you will be able to improve existing checkout features and add new functions. What’s more, you can also replace specific elements as needed.
Types of ‘Shopify customize checkout’
That being said, let’s explore two primary checkout customization options at your disposal. The first involves simple theme modifications that you can handle on your own, while the second entails adding extra functionalities through Shopify apps.
1. Effortless Visual Customizations for Your Shopify Checkout
To start customizing your Shopify checkout without external assistance, follow these simple steps:
- Firstly, click on “Customize” next to your active theme.
- Select “Checkout” from the top menu.
- Navigate to the “Checkout” section within the Theme settings on the left.

With the Theme Editor, you have the flexibility to make various straightforward checkout customizations:
- Incorporate Your Logo: Maintain brand consistency by adding logo to checkout for a strong, recognizable presence over store name.
- Adjust Colors: Change the page’s colors, text, links, buttons to match brand. While setting a background image for main content and order summary is possible, it’s not recommended due to potential visibility issues.
- Select Fonts: Pick from Shopify’s font selection to personalize the checkout’s appearance and complement your brand.

- Personalized Header: Elevate the checkout page’s appearance by including a customized banner or a fitting image as the page header, a small yet impactful change.

Navigate to Shopify admin, then under the Checkout and Accounts section, you can make changes to various fields:
- Adjust Marketing Signups: Email and SMS signups can be personalized by replacing the default “Email me with news and offers” with a message of your choice. Click on the “Customize checkbox labels” and input your preferred wording in the provided fields.

If you aim to emphasize these fields with a unique design or have more control over their placement, standard settings won’t suffice. To tailor the signup boxes, you’ll need to rely on Shopify apps or implement custom code.
Additionally, within the admin settings, you have the flexibility to set customer login preferences, including allowing guest checkouts and enabling Multipass.
Furthermore, you can also determine which content fields are essential or optional, such as the choice to include or exclude the “address line 2” field.

Lastly, you can allow customers to leave tips at checkout if it aligns with your business strategy, enabling them to express their appreciation for your products and services.
2. Customizing Shopify Checkout with Apps and Tools
Several applications can help you perfect your checkout process and boost conversions. Here are some examples of what you can achieve:
- Progress Bar: Replace the default breadcrumbs with a progress bar to clearly illustrate the number of steps required to complete an order.

- Free Shipping: Show the free shipping threshold at multiple purchase stages, including your store’s header, cart page, cart drawer, and checkout (when the free shipping condition isn’t met).

- Gift with Purchase: Give a complimentary gift with purchases and display it in the order summary when specific conditions, like a spending threshold, are met.

- Post-Purchase Offers: Implement upselling and cross-selling techniques, even at the checkout stage, by incorporating post-purchase offers on the thank-you page.
- Countdown Timer: Add a countdown timer for urgency, driving customers to complete purchases quickly and boost conversions.

- Email and SMS Updates: Allow customers to sign up for email and SMS updates, offering flexibility in presenting signup options.

- Trust Badges: Incorporate trust badges to instill confidence in customers, highlighting supported payment methods and trust indicators.
- Information and Benefits: Display contact information and product benefits below the order summary to engage customers effectively.

- Customer Interaction: Encourage customers to leave comments or provide personalization requests using additional fields in the checkout.

- Sticky Order Summary: Keep the order summary in view by using a sticky order summary that moves along with the customer’s scroll.
- Single-Page Checkout: A single-page checkout can be implemented for a streamlined and convenient ordering experience.
